Position Overview:
The HR Manager is responsible for overseeing and executing all aspects of human resources functions at the Dover facility. This includes employee relations, labor relations in a union environment, recruitment, benefits administration, compliance, and HR policy implementation. This position plays a critical role in fostering a positive work environment, ensuring legal compliance, and supporting plant leadership to meet operational goals.
Primary Responsibilities
Employee Relations & HR Administration
- Serve as the primary HR contact for all hourly and salaried plant employees
- Manage and investigate employee concerns, complaints, and disciplinary matters in accordance with company policies
- Support a positive labor relations environment through proactive engagement and consistent policy enforcement
- Provide guidance and coaching to supervisors and managers on performance management and corrective action
- Conduct and document investigations and ensure timely resolution
Recruitment & Onboarding
- Manage full-cycle recruitment for plant roles, including working with staffing agencies
- Coordinate onboarding and orientation for new hires, ensuring smooth integration into the workforce
- Maintain accurate and up-to-date employee records in Paycom
- Coordinate background screenings, employment verifications, and job postings
Benefits & Payroll Support
- Educate employees on available benefits and assist with enrollments, changes, and terminations
- Partner with HR Director to support Open Enrollment and wellness initiatives
- Assist with payroll process and resolve timekeeping issues
Compliance & Reporting
- Ensure compliance with federal, state, and local employment laws, including FMLA, ADA, EEO, and OSHA requirements
- Maintain labor law postings and coordinate training related to harassment prevention, safety, and compliance
- Monitor and report on attendance and turnover trends; prepare monthly/quarterly reports for leadership
- Process and track workers' compensation claims; partner with carriers and internal stakeholders as needed
Union Relations
- Support a union environment in accordance with the collective bargaining agreement
- Maintain effective communication with union representatives and participate in grievance discussions
- Assist in labor negotiations and prepare documentation as needed
Culture, Engagement & Communication
- Help plan employee engagement events, recognition programs, and wellness activities
- Contribute to the development of company newsletters and internal communications
- Foster a culture of safety, teamwork, and continuous improvement
Qualifications
Qualifications:
-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ources or related field preferred
- 3–5 years of HR experience in a manufacturing or industrial environment required
- 2–3 years in a leadership or supervisory role, with experience managing direct reports or leading HR initiatives
- Experience in a unionized facility highly preferred
- Working knowledge of employment law and HR best practices
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ite and HRIS systems (Paycom a plus)
- Strong interpersonal, organizational, and problem-solving skills
- Ability to handle sensitive and confidential matters with professionalism
Working Environment:
This position is primarily based in an office setting within a manufacturing facility. The HR Manager will be required to spend time on the production floor to support employee engagement, safety initiatives, and operational needs. Walking, standing, and wearing required personal protective equipment (PPE) may be necessary when on the plant floor. The role may occasionally require flexibility in hours to support multiple shifts.
